Popular State Parks Near Yachats, OR

State Parks Near Yachats, ORSouth Beach State Park is a popular destination for RV enthusiasts and campers, located on the central Oregon coast. The park offers a variety of camping options, including RV sites with full hookups, tent sites, and yurts. With over 200 campsites available, it is recommended to make reservations in advance, especially during peak season. The park boasts easy access to a beautiful sandy beach where visitors can enjoy activities like swimming, beachcombing, and kite flying.Beverly Beach State Park is known for its picturesque coastline and breathtaking views. Enjoy recreational activities such as swimming and sunbathing on the sandy beaches. Take a leisurely stroll along the scenic hiking trails offering panoramic views of the Pacific Ocean. Set up camp in one of the well-maintained RV or tent sites equipped with picnic tables and fire rings. Immerse yourself in diverse wildlife and visit the historic Yaquina Head Lighthouse adjacent to the park.Umpqua Lighthouse State Park offers various camping options including RV sites with full hookups, tent sites, and yurts.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ore hiking trails that take you through diverse landscapes such as forests, sand dunes, and beaches. Fishing opportunities are available along with birdwatching and beachcombing activities.Sunset Bay State Park features stunning views of the Pacific Ocean with a beautiful sandy beach for sunbathing and swimming. RV camping is available with spacious sites to accommodate small or large RVs. The park offers amenities such as restrooms, showers, and picnic areas overlooking the ocean.These state parks near Yachats provide an opportunity for RV travelers to experience Oregon's natural beauty while enjoying various out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, beachcombing, and wildlife observation.

Must-see Monuments and Landmarks Near Yachats, OR

National Sites and Monuments Near Yachats, ORLewis and Clark National and State Historical Parks offer a rich history and stunning natural beauty. Commemorating the famous expedition of Meriwether Lewis and William Clark, these parks provide a glimpse into the past. Explore the Lewis and Clark Interpretive Center for an in-depth look at their journey, and enjoy recreational activities like hiking, biking, camping, and wildlife viewing.Fort Vancouver National Historic Site in Washington State was once the headquarters of the Hudson's Bay Company's Columbia Department. Immerse yourself in the region's fur trade history by exploring the reconstructed fort and visiting the Pearson Air Museum. Nearby campgrounds accommodate RVs, including Paradise Point State Park, Battle Ground Lake State Park, and Vancouver RV Park.Oregon Caves National Monument and Preserve features a unique underground marble cave system. Take guided tours through stunning chambers showcasing intricate formations. Enjoy hiking, picnicking, wildlife watching, and bird spotting. The monument offers RV camping nearby with basic amenities.Tule Lake National Monument in California is associated with World War II Japanese-American internment. RV camping is available at Indian Well Campground in Modoc National Forest. Explore hiking trails with scenic views, go fishing for largemouth bass or yellow perch, and visit the visitor center for exhibits on the park's history.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

Campgrounds, RV Parks and RV Resorts Near Yachats, OR:Rovers RV Park: This RV campground in Yachats, Oregon offers showers, allows pets, and has good cell reception. Darlings Marina & RV Resort: Located in Yachats, this resort features a general store, laundry facilities, water hookups, and a community BBQ/grill. It is perfect for kite-boarding enthusiasts.Sea & Sand RV Park: With 109 RV sites offering full hookups for both 30/50 Amp, this park provides showers, pet-friendly accommodations, reliable cell reception, and Wi-Fi. They offer discounts for extended stays.Coyote Rock RV Resort & Marina: Rates vary from $29.70 to $39.60 per day based on site amenities and location. This resort offers 63 back-in sites with full hookups for both 30/50 Amp. Enjoy amenities like volleyball and basketball courts and horseshoes while enjoying reliable cell reception.

RV Dump Stations Near Yachats, OR

- When you're in Yachats, Oregon, you'll find a few convenient options for dumping your RV tanks.- Ash Creek Mobile & RV Park offers a dump station along with fresh water and a hose for flushing tanks.- Premier RV Resorts in Salem is another nearby option that provides dumping facilities for both black and gray water.- If you're an Elks Lodge member, the Elks Lodge in Newport has a dump station available for use.- Hee Hee Illahee RV Resort, located in nearby Salem, also offers a dump station for your convenience.- Remember to dispose of your trash properly in the designated RV waste disposal bins.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Toy Hauler Near Yachats, OR

How do I correctly load and secure my recreational equipment in the toy hauler rental, such as ATVs or dirt bikes, and are there any weight or size limitations I need to be aware of?

It is important to properly load and secure your recreational equipment in the toy hauler rental to ensure safety during travel. Most toy haulers come equipped with tie-downs and rails specifically designed for securing equipment. It is important to follow the manufacturer's guidelines for weight capacity and loading instructions. You should also check with the owner of the RVshare rental for any specific instructions or recommendations.

Can I bring fuel and oil for my recreational equipment, or should I purchase these items after reaching my destination?

It is generally recommended to purchase fuel and oil for your recreational equipment after reaching your destination. Many RV parks and campgrounds have restrictions on fuel storage for safety reasons.
